Foley Partner, Adam Lenain, moderated a discussion with energy consultant David Andresen, Joseph Balagot of Dawson James Securities, Leif Christoffersen of Teotl Energy Partners, and David Saltman, one of the founders of CleanTECH San Diego, on the future of alternative energy with an emphasis on the production of biofuels. Topics included the state-of-the-art in biofuel production and the future of the alternative energy sector. Which technology is likely to prevail? Or, are they all a part of the solution?
